You drive your car for three hours at an average speed of 130 km/h how far did you go

Answer:

390 KM

Step-by-step explanation:

Every 130 kilometers, an hour passes by. This means, that if you drive for 3 hours, you must multiply those 130 kilometers by 3.

130*3=390
